Biophysicochemical PropertiesKinetic parameters: KM=3.5 uM for estrone ;
Catalytic Activity17-beta-estradiol + NAD(P)(+) = estrone + NAD(P)H.
DomainThe di-lysine motif confers endoplasmic reticulum localization for type I membrane proteins.
FunctionCatalyzes the transformation of estrone (E1) into estradiol (E2), suggesting a central role in estrogen formation. Its strong expression in ovary and mammary gland suggest that it may constitute the major enzyme responsible for the conversion of E1 to E2 in women. Also has 3-ketoacyl-CoA reductase activity, reducing both long chain 3-ketoacyl-CoAs and long chain fatty acyl-CoAs, suggesting a role in long fatty acid elongation.
PathwayLipid metabolism; fatty acid biosynthesis.
PathwaySteroid biosynthesis; estrogen biosynthesis.
Sequence CautionSequence=AK027882; Type=Frameshift; Positions=92; Evidence= ;
SimilarityBelongs to the short-chain dehydrogenases/reductases (SDR) family. 17-beta-HSD 3 subfamily.
Subcellular LocationEndoplasmic reticulum membrane ; Multi-pass membrane protein .
SubunitInteracts with ELOVL1 and LASS2.
Tissue SpecificityExpressed in most tissues tested. Highly expressed in the ovary and mammary. Expressed in platelets. {ECO
